Discover more about Gibraltar Botanic Gardens

Nestled amidst the stunning backdrop of the Rock of Gibraltar, the Gibraltar Botanic Gardens is a serene retreat that showcases a rich diversity of plant species from around the globe. Established in the 19th century, these gardens are not just a feast for the eyes but also a significant part of the region's natural heritage, making it a perfect destination for nature lovers and casual tourists alike. As you stroll through the garden's winding paths, you'll encounter an array of exotic plants, including subtropical and Mediterranean species, beautifully complemented by the occasional peacock strutting through the grounds. The well-maintained flower beds burst with color and fragrance, creating an inviting atmosphere that encourages leisurely exploration. The gardens are also home to several historic features, including a charming Victorian fountain and remnants of the area's military history, which offer insights into Gibraltar's past. Visitors can find peaceful spots to relax on benches or enjoy a picnic while taking in the bre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ape and the Mediterranean Sea. With a variety of walking trails, the gardens cater to both leisurely strolls and more vigorous hikes, allowing everyone to engage with nature at their own pace. The Gibraltar Botanic Gardens are open daily, providing ample opportunity for visitors to immerse themselves in this botanical paradise. Whether you are seeking a quiet moment of reflection or a family-friendly outing, the gardens provide an ideal setting to unwind and appreciate the natural beauty of Gibraltar.
